8328. @ Cacks: Who says Civ V will recognise that code?quote>

The code is not for the game but for the shortcut for the game, it is the same for many other programs and works with them therefore it should work with Civ V, your not altering the game in any way, just the game's 'target path' with

-CustomResolution:enabled -rRESOLUTIONxRESOLUTION


as an example:

-CustomResolution:enabled -r800x600 -w

this forces the game to run in 800x600, you could add a -W at the end as well (maybe) that will make it run in a window (I'll have to test that)... it should work for all applications.
